Advanced Industrial Liquid Cooling Modules Data Sheet
Pump | Model | A2 | |
Voltage | 12V | ||
Speed | 3200RPM | ||
Radiator | Dimensions | 200x190x95mm | |
Material | Aluminum | ||
Tube | Dimensions | Φ13x400mm | |
Material | EPDM | ||
Fan | Dimensions | 92x92x38mm | |
Voltage | 12V | ||
Speed | 6000RPM | ||
Air flow(max) | 120.58CFM | ||
Prerssure(max) | 2mm/H2O | ||
Noise | 58.3dBA | ||
Quantity | 2Pcs | ||
Power dissipation | 150w/300W |
